You can dissolve about 1g of chloroform in a 100g of water; slightly less if the water is hot. This would not generally be considered ‘soluble’, but it’s not entirely negligible either, depending on your purposes. The Environmental Protection Agency (EPA) has established Disinfection … See more Chloroform gets into water during disinfection.Public water supplies are treated with chlorine, chloramine, or other chemicals to prevent … See more WebAug 25, 2024 · Chloroform easily dissolves in water, but doesn’t stick to soil well. This means it may travel down through soil and pollute groundwater sources during snow or rainfall. For this reason, chloroform is often found in private well water supplies – even if well owners don’t disinfect their water with chlorine.

Coat dishes with recommended concentrations in … two\u0027s difficulty chart obbyWebSep 27, 2024 · Does chloroform dissolve in water? Chloroform can move very easily from water into the air. Chloroform stays in air for a long time. It also dissolves easily in water, which means it can easily move into groundwater. Once chloroform is in groundwater, it is expected the chemical will be in the groundwater for a long time.
